These facts are ones important for you to know about them:
•Priceline completed its acquisition of Kayak for $1.8 billion.
•Kayak can be of strategic importance for Priceline to close the gap with Expedia EXPE +0.03% in the U.S. market. Priceline’s share in the U.S. travel bookings was just 11% in 2012 vs. 43% for Expedia.
•Despite slowing growth, the U.S. online travel market remains the biggest market in terms of sales and will continue to be so for years to come.
Growing at a CAGR of 47%, Kayak’s top line witnessed robust growth between 2007-2012. The company currently receives about 80% of its revenue from the U.S. and has over 50% share of the U.S. meta-search market. We believe that by attracting more traffic to Priceline’s website, Kayak’s acquisition can increase the company’s booking transactions in the region.

Cheaper fuel helps 2Q results at Delta, US Airways
Figures released Wednesday by the Department of Transportation showed fares were virtually unchanged in the first three months of this year from a year earlier.
Both airlines beat Wall Street expectations and offered upbeat forecasts about travel demand for the rest of the summer and into September.
Despite all the grumbling about the price of travel, especially those unpopular fees for everything from checking a bag to getting a seat with decent legroom, airline revenue isn't growing much. It was flat at Delta and up just 3 percent at US Airways.
Delta executives said that business travelers — especially those in the banking and finance sector — were coming back. That's significant because corporate travelers usually pay much higher fares than leisure passengers who book far in advance.
US Airways President Scott Kirby said business travel was weaker in March, April and May, contributing to the second-quarter decline in revenue per mile, but it recovered in June
